Lectures & Seminars
Médecins Sans Frontières participates in and organises a range of specialised lectures, conferences, workshops and seminars throughout the year. Some are open to the public and others only to affiliated audiences.
In 2012 activities will include the International Women's Day 2012 Forum to be held in Sydney and Melbourne, featuring Médecins Sans Frontières Australia's two Medical Advisors on Women's Health who will present on maternal health and the role of emergency obstetrics to reduce maternal mortality [see below].
